Output 5772395b545682dd7551aeff779bcf83ddf23ada2e46865b9bc824e0f0e2d496:3

value
18925244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c1b982ed956b7cab3c416a84df72eb0fb25f89 OP_EQUAL
address
3DLXp8ZTSjKZWF1T2sDuFxQa2PZLnbwRG3
transaction
5772395b545682dd7551aeff779bcf83ddf23ada2e46865b9bc824e0f0e2d496
spent
true